We create synergy with Crystal Pottebaum, speaking about all things service learning, sustainability, and the systems and experiences that get us there!

Crystal Pottebaum is a K–12 Service and Sustainability Learning Coordinator who is passionate about connecting learning with meaningful action. With experience in international schools across Africa, Asia, and Europe, Crystal supports students and educators in embedding service learning, sustainability, and global citizenship into the curriculum in authentic and impactful ways. Her work centers on building long-term community partnerships, empowering student changemakers, and designing systems that help schools move from good intentions to measurable impact. Crystal believes that education should extend beyond the classroom and equip students to engage compassionately with the world around them. In addition to her work in education, she is also a children’s book author, using storytelling to inspire curiosity, empathy, and a sense of responsibility in young learners.
